Transaction 06edf761c2fa123d7f85cab95f48500174169098988804c12b3eba1425efc186
2 Input
2 Outputs
- 06edf761c2fa123d7f85cab95f48500174169098988804c12b3eba1425efc186:0
- 06edf761c2fa123d7f85cab95f48500174169098988804c12b3eba1425efc186:1
value 15342285
address 152ZN2mDccrDwEB1kC9eWb4ZZEq8m2d83f
value 300000
address 391pUW77Qo2rTbDgM8y7CQ6x3PggeadCmD